Morgan Wallen: From Small Town Dreamer to Country Music Star
Morgan Wallen has become one of the most talked-about and successful figures in modern country music. With his signature mullet, his distinctive voice, and a sound that blends traditional country with influences from rock, pop, and hip-hop, Wallen’s rise to fame is as much a story of personal redemption as it is of musical triumph.
| Life | About Morgan Wallen |
|---|---|
| Early Life | Born on May 13, 1993, in Sneedville, Tennessee. Wallen grew up surrounded by church music. He originally pursued baseball but turned to music after a sports injury. |
| The Voice Journey | Wallen competed in The Voice in 2014, where he started with Usher’s team and switched to Adam Levine’s. Although eliminated, it helped launch his music career. |
| Musical Breakthrough | His debut album If I Know Me (2018) included the hit “Whiskey Glasses,” which became his breakout song, resonating with fans for its relatable theme of heartbreak. |
| Dangerous: The Double Album | Dangerous (2021) became a massive success, debuting at No. 1 on the Billboard 200. It included hits like “7 Summers” and “More Than My Hometown.” |
| Controversy | In 2021, Wallen faced backlash after a video surfaced of him using a racial slur. His music was removed from radio, and he took time off to reflect, apologize, and enter rehab. |
| Return to Stage | Wallen returned to the stage in 2022, winning Album of the Year at the ACM Awards. His comeback was marked by performances that reflected his personal growth and faith. |
| One Thing at a Time | His 2023 album One Thing at a Time debuted at No. 1, with the lead single “Last Night” spending 16 weeks at the top of the Billboard Hot 100. |
| Musical Style | Wallen blends country with rock, pop, and hip-hop influences. His songs often reflect themes of love, heartbreak, and small-town life, resonating deeply with a broad audience. |
